Here's What You Should Know About Cement

When you're working on a construction project, it's important to know all you can about the materials you are working with. Cement is crucial to many different types of construction such as concrete driveway repairs. According to House Grail, cement is a key ingredient in concrete and over four billion tons of cement are produced annually. Let's go over some helpful information about cement.


What Is Cement?


The words cement and concrete are often interchanged, but they're actually two different things. Cement is actually a component of concrete. It's also an integral component of mortar. This is a primary building material that is used in many structures. Examples of these structures include sidewalks and roads. If the cement that's used in concrete isn't of good quality, it can create safety hazards and become a drain on resources when surfaces need to be redone.


Concrete is considered to be a composite material that is formed by mixing what are called aggregates. Aggregates can be sand, gravel, or crushed stone. These aggregates are mixed with a paste. The paste is made of water and an adhesive. Cement is not often used on its own, but rather is mixed with other ingredients to create stronger materials. It's often used in structural applications. Mixed with the aggregates, cement can be transformed into concrete. Often the word cement is just used as a generic term that refers to one of many different formulas. These different formulas and types of materials have the common characteristic of serving as a binder for aggregates to be changed into concrete.


Portland Cement


Portland cement is made using calcium silicate. This is made from a combination of calcium, silicon, aluminum, and iron oxides. This is probably the most common type of cement. It's used for general concrete applications. This is usually what you think of when you hear the term concrete.


Portland cement is considered to be hydraulic cement. This means that it sets and bonds through a chemical reaction happening between water and dry ingredients. Non-hydraulic cement does not set in water. They require other technology in order to create the needed bond between the ingredients.


Cement Grades


Cement comes in differing grades depending on how the material will be used. General construction requires a grade of 33, according to the Contractors State License Board. A grade of 43 is often used for more intensive load-bearing construction such as foundations or concrete driveway repairs. Higher grades such as 53 can be used for projects that would require extreme strength and durability such as skyscrapers, bridges, and roads.
